1 Bag Plants 1/2 Acres
This 25 pound mix has been designed for that late summer annual planting that will provide quality food source, with forage soybeans, buckwheat, winter peas, and berseem clover through fall season, but also provides the benefit of winter wheat through the winter. Since the wheat species is awnless, this food plot mix will provide value all the way into summer.
Mix includes: Berseem clover, Buckwheat, Awnless wheat, Winter pea, Forage soybeans
